What are primary skills?

by Rik

Primary skills are those that are essential to the job, while secondary skills are those that would be beneficial to have but are not essential. For example, if you are applying for a job as a web developer, then primary skills might include H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, while secondary skills might include PHP and MySQL.

What are the hard skills?

Hard skills are objective, quantifiable skills gained through training, school, or work experiences. Hard skills are often usually something that can be taught or learned. For that reason, hard skills can typically be easily proven — you either know how to write code, or you don’t. Jul 14, 2022

What is the most important soft skill and why?

Communication skills are almost always high on the ‘essential skills’ list in any job advertisement. People with strong communication skills can build relationships (from the initial rapport-building through to a longer-term relationship).

Why is it called soft skills?

A soft skill is a personal attribute that supports situational awareness and enhances an individual’s ability to get a job done. The term soft skills is often used as a synonym for people skills or emotional intelligence.

What are quantitative skills?

What do we mean by quantitative skills? We mean those skills related to empirical inquiry via mathematical, statistical, or computational data gathering and analysis. In other words, the ability to take data (numerical, categorical, or ordinal), or scientific concepts, and make sense of them.

What is soft thinking?

Soft thinking is playful, spontaneous, dreamlike, and less concerned with finding the answer as compared to hard thinking. Soft thinking is a necessary part of creativity. But hard thinking is also part of the process. Creativity may thrive on spontaneity but order and analytical thinking is important to be successful. Jun 9, 2013

Who is the father of creativity?

Known around the world as the “Father of Creativity,” Torrance developed the Torrance Test for Creative Thinking as a faculty member at the University of Minnesota. The test became the benchmark method for quantifying creativity and created the platform for all research on the subject since.

What are the 7 principles of critical thinking?

Critical thinking involves asking questions, defining a problem, examining evidence, analyzing assumptions and biases, avoiding emotional reasoning, avoiding oversimplification, considering other interpretations, and tolerating ambiguity.
